The switch wielded by Uncle Sam in School Begins merely symbolized the violent nature of American expansion, that is, until 1900 when Teddy Roosevelt first said speak softly and carry a big stick and you will go far. The switch now can be interpreted as the big stick, which became highly symbolic of American imperialism, especially after the Philippine Insurrection and the American forays into Latin America after the Roosevelt Corollary to the Monroe Doctrine was adopted. Dairymples cartoon is a depiction of a classroom in which the states and territories are represented as children and Uncle Sam is the draconian-looking teacher, peering down at his pupils through a pair of spectacles that give him a more scholarly appearance. In this French political cartoon from 1898, the Qing official observespowerlessly as a pastry representing China is divided up by Queen Victoria of the United Kingdom, William II of Germany, Nicholas II of Russia, the French Marianne, and asamurai of Japan. In summary, both cartoons depicted objects that contained powerful symbolism, like the battleship, the cigars, the book, or the switch. The corpulence of Gillams 1899 Uncle Sam is a testament to the success of capitalism through imperialist policies, while the gaunt, towering figure of Dairymples 1899 Uncle Sam appears much more menacing to the cowering, defiant children that represent newly acquired territories. 0 3.
